Sabre Corporation: A Detailed Analysis

Company Profile

History and Background

Sabre Corporation (NASDAQ: SABR) is a leading technology provider to the global travel industry. Founded in 1960 as the airline reservation system for American Airlines, Sabre has evolved into a comprehensive provider of software, data, and mobile solutions for airlines, hotels, travel agencies, and other travel industry players.

Through its two primary segments, Travel Solutions and Hospitality Solutions, Sabre provides a wide range of products and services, including reservation systems, revenue management tools, distribution channels, and data analytics.

Core Business Areas

  • Travel Solutions: This segment focuses on providing technology solutions for airlines, travel agencies, and other travel intermediaries. Key offerings include the SabreSonic reservation system, the SynXis central reservation system for hotels, and the GetThere corporate travel management platform.

  • Hospitality Solutions: This segment caters to the needs of hotels and other hospitality providers. It offers solutions for guest management, revenue optimization, and distribution. The primary product in this segment is the SynXis Central Reservation System.

Sabre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, operates as software and technology company for travel industry in the United States, Europe, Asia-Pacific, and internationally. It operates through two segments: Travel Solutions and Hospitality Solutions. The Travel Solutions segment operates a business-to-business travel marketplace that offers travel content, such as inventory, prices, and availability from a range of travel suppliers, including airlines, hotels, car rental brands, rail carriers, cruise lines, and tour operators with a network of travel buyers comprising online and offline travel agencies, travel management companies, and corporate travel departments. This segment provides a portfolio of software technology products and solutions through software-as-a-service (SaaS) and hosted delivery models to airlines and other travel suppliers. Its products include reservation systems for carriers, commercial and operations products, agency solutions, and data-driven intelligence solutions. Its Hospitality Solutions segment provides software and solutions to hoteliers through SaaS and hosted delivery models. Sabre Corporation was incorporated in 2006 and is headquartered in Southlake, Texas.
